How many protons neutrons and electrons are in H2O?

A water molecule has two hydrogen atoms and one oxygen atom. The proton, neutron and electron count of them are 1,0,1 and 8,8,8 respectively. Therefore a molecule of water has 10 protons, 8 neutrons and 10 electrons.

How many protons electrons neutrons are in a molecule of carbon dioxide how many in a molecule of calcium nitrate?

Carbon Dioxide has the formula of CO2, which means 1 Carbon atom and 2 Oxygen atom per CO2 molecule. Carbon12 has 6 protons, 6 neutrons and 6 electrons per atom. Oxygen has 8 protons, 8 neutrons and 8 electrons per atom. One CO2 molecule contains 22 protons, 22 neutrons and 22 electrons. Calcium Nitrate has the formula of Ca(NO3)2. Calcium contains 20 of each. Nitrogen contains 7 of each. Oxygen contains 8 of each. Per molecule there are 1 calcium, 2 Nitrogen and 6 oxygen.
